Next Tip  Access and Excel Data Entry Keyboard Tips

Following are my favourite data entry tips.  Try setting up a form with these and other tips and copy it into your new databases to offer some immediate productivity for your software.  Have a button on your data entry forms to fire it up.

Press the   CTRL and  "    keys at the same time to copy down the data from the same field in the record above.
 



Press the CTRL  and  +   keys at the same time to finish entry on the current line and commence entry on a new record
 


When entering dates, try the  12 5 
(12 space 5) for 12 May in the current year. 


Press the CTRL  and  :   keys at the same time to enter the current date into the field.
